Campbell Barton e955c94ed3 License Headers: Set copyright to "Blender Authors", add AUTHORS
Listing the "Blender Foundation" as copyright holder implied the Blender
Foundation holds copyright to files which may include work from many
developers.

While keeping copyright on headers makes sense for isolated libraries,
Blender's own code may be refactored or moved between files in a way
that makes the per file copyright holders less meaningful.

Copyright references to the "Blender Foundation" have been replaced with
"Blender Authors", with the exception of `./extern/` since these this
contains libraries which are more isolated, any changed to license
headers there can be handled on a case-by-case basis.

Some directories in `./intern/` have also been excluded:

- `./intern/cycles/` it's own `AUTHORS` file is planned.
- `./intern/opensubdiv/`.

An "AUTHORS" file has been added, using the chromium projects authors
file as a template.

Design task: #110784

Ref !110783.

#!/usr/bin/env python3
# SPDX-FileCopyrightText: 2023 Blender Authors
#
# SPDX-License-Identifier: GPL-2.0-or-later
import subprocess
import os
from os.path import join
from autopep8_clean_config import PATHS, PATHS_EXCLUDE
from typing import (
Callable,
Generator,
Optional,
Sequence,
)
# Useful to disable when debugging warnings.
USE_MULTIPROCESS = True
print(PATHS)
SOURCE_EXT = (
# Python
".py",
)
def is_source_and_included(filename: str) -> bool:
return (
filename.endswith(SOURCE_EXT) and
filename not in PATHS_EXCLUDE
)
def path_iter(
path: str,
filename_check: Optional[Callable[[str], bool]] = None,
) -> Generator[str, None, None]:
for dirpath, dirnames, filenames in os.walk(path):
# skip ".git"
dirnames[:] = [d for d in dirnames if not d.startswith(".")]
for filename in filenames:
if filename.startswith("."):
continue
filepath = join(dirpath, filename)
if filename_check is None or filename_check(filepath):
yield filepath
def path_expand(
paths: Sequence[str],
filename_check: Optional[Callable[[str], bool]] = None,
) -> Generator[str, None, None]:
for f in paths:
if not os.path.exists(f):
print("Missing:", f)
elif os.path.isdir(f):
yield from path_iter(f, filename_check)
else:
yield f
def autopep8_format_file(f: str) -> None:
print(f)
subprocess.call((
"autopep8",
"--ignore",
",".join((
# Info: Use `isinstance()` instead of comparing types directly.
# Why disable?: Changes code logic, in rare cases we want to compare exact types.
"E721",
# Info: Fix bare except.
# Why disable?: Disruptive, leave our exceptions alone.
"E722",
# Info: Fix module level import not at top of file.
# Why disable?: re-ordering imports is disruptive and breaks some scripts
# that need to check if a module has already been loaded in the case of reloading.
"E402",
# Info: Try to make lines fit within --max-line-length characters.
# Why disable? Causes lines to be wrapped, where long lines have the
# trailing bracket moved to the end of the line.
# If trailing commas were respected as they are by clang-format this might be acceptable.
# Note that this doesn't disable all line wrapping.
"E501",
# Info: Fix various deprecated code (via lib2to3)
# Why disable?: causes imports to be added/re-arranged.
"W690",
)),
"--aggressive",
"--in-place",
"--max-line-length", "120",
f,
))
def main() -> None:
import sys
if os.path.samefile(sys.argv[-1], __file__):
paths = path_expand(PATHS, is_source_and_included)
else:
paths = path_expand(sys.argv[1:], is_source_and_included)
if USE_MULTIPROCESS:
import multiprocessing
job_total = multiprocessing.cpu_count()
pool = multiprocessing.Pool(processes=job_total * 2)
pool.map(autopep8_format_file, paths)
else:
for f in paths:
autopep8_format_file(f)
if __name__ == "__main__":
main()
